Nivalis and MCT Enter Non-Exclusive Dealer Agreement
Nivalis Energy Systems, a leading innovator in TRU electrification systems, has signed a non-exclusive dealer agreement with MCT Companies, marking a significant step forward in the deployment of clean transportation solutions for the cold chain logistics industry across California. Under the agreement, all MCT Companies locations in California will now offer the Nivalis TRU-Power ™ 6800 battery system. This proprietary system integrates state-of-the-art components, design, and manufacturing to deliver a cutting-edge electric trailer refrigeration unit (TRU) solution. TRU-Power ™ 6800 is engineered to pair seamlessly with Carrier Vector units, delivering a zero-emission refrigeration solution that meets the growing demand for sustainable fleet operations. With diesel prices remaining volatile and regulatory penalties increasing for emissions non-compliance, the shift to electric TRU technology offers a clear economic advantage through reductions in total cost of ownership. The collaboration between Nivalis Energy Systems, LLC and MCT Companies underscores a growing momentum in the refrigerated transport industry toward cleaner, quieter, and more efficient technologies that reduce harmful emissions without compromising performance.
Nuvve Acquires Fermata Energy
Nuvve, a global leader in vehicle-to-grid (V2G) technology and grid modernization, has acquired the majority of Fermata Energy, another V2G platform provider. Nuvve’s newly formed subsidiary, “Fermata 2.0” is focused on scaling intelligent, bidirectional energy solutions. Key members of the Fermata team will join Fermata 2.0, bringing expertise in V2G integration, software development, OEM and utility engagement, regulatory strategy, business operations, and business development. The companies will continue to support and expand existing customer and partner relationships, ensuring collaborations are preserved and enhanced through the integration. By assimilating technologies, customers will receive a more scalable, flexible, and commercially powerful solution than they would otherwise.
Rivian Announces Major Investment in Illinois
Rivian has announced a nearly $120 million investment to build a 1.2 million square-foot supplier park in Normal, Illinois, to boost domestic development and production. Construction is underway and is expected to create 100 jobs upon completion next year. The goal of the park is to encourage suppliers to relocate to Normal to produce and provide components for Rivian closer to operations in Illinois. The state is providing Rivian with a $16 million incentive package to help support the project through a tax incentive program and capital grant support. Amidst tariffs that could raise costs on imported vehicles and auto parts, along with steel and aluminum, Rivian is the latest automaker to commit to boosting domestic production to hopefully keep costs as low as possible.
GM and LG Reveal New Battery Technology
GM and LG Energy Solution have launched the “first-ever” lithium manganese-rich (LMR) prismatic EV battery cells, intended for upcoming GM EV models. While there are no EVs currently with LMR batteries, GM believes they’ve figured out a solution that allegedly unlocks 33% higher energy density than lithium iron phosphate batteries at a comparable cost. GM plans to use the new battery cells in future electric trucks and SUVs, aiming for 400+ miles of range with “significant battery cost savings.” GM and LG are planning to begin commercial production of LMR prismatic cells in the US in 2028.
